443218 2021-07-10T07:44:48 Z flashhh Art Exhibition (JOI18_art) C++14
100 / 100
261 ms 20828 KB
#include <bits/stdc++.h>
#define ll long long 
#define nmax 500010
#define pii pair<ll,ll>
#define fi first
#define se second

using namespace std;

int n;
ll mi=1e18,sum,res;
pii a[nmax];

int main()
{
    ios_base::sync_with_stdio(0); cin.tie(0); cout.tie(0);
    
    cin>>n;
    for (int i=1;i<=n;++i) cin>>a[i].fi>>a[i].se;
    
    sort(a+1,a+n+1);
    
    for (int i=1;i<=n;++i)
    {
        mi=min(mi,sum-a[i].fi);
        sum+=a[i].se;
        res=max(res,sum-a[i].fi-mi);
    }

    cout<<res;
    
    return 0;
}
